WebApr 28, 2024 · The Constitution of India by Article 153 Creates the Office the Governor. Each State shall have a Governor, However one person can be appointed Governor for two or more State. Under Art 155 The Governor of a State is appointed by the President of India. He is neither elected by the Direct vote of the People nor by an Indirect vote by a ...
